Easy to clean

If you own a Delonghi coffee maker, it's important to keep it clean. This will ensure that it produces high-quality espresso and ensure that the machine will last for many years. It's not that difficult to do so. All you need are a few basic items. You'll require a soft sponge or cloth as well as warm soapy tap water and a descaling solution. You will also need a brush for cleaning the portafilter's handle and paper towels to wipe up spills.

If your Delonghi has an integrated automatic descaling process, you're in luck. If, however, your machine does not have this feature, coffee Machine delonghi you'll have to manually descale it. Many people prefer natural products, such as vinegar, to commercial descalers. They are not as harmful and are can be found in most grocery stores. They are also less expensive. They aren't as efficient and may cause warranty voiding as commercial descalers.

Aside from vinegar and acetic acid, you can also try citric acid or lemon. Citrus fruits and vegetables are rich in natural acids. They are affordable and readily available in health food stores or on the internet. They can also be bought in powder form and mixed with some water to create an homemade descaling solution. However, it is advised to wash the machine thoroughly afterwards to avoid any lingering vinegar odors.

Using a vinegar-based descaler will stop the buildup of limescale and help your machine run more efficiently. It also protects the internal components of the machine from damage caused by hardwater. If you are unsure of the hardness of your water then you can purchase a test kit that determines the hardness. The more difficult your machine is going to be to use and the more calcium is it able to contain. Installing a water softener, or using a coffee maker that is adapted for hard water can lower the chance of scaling. This will save you money on energy costs and extend the life of your Delonghi.

Repairs are easy

Delonghi coffee machines are a great addition to your kitchen. It makes delicious cappuccinos and espresso, but like all appliances, it will need some maintenance every now and then. A few simple steps will keep your coffee maker in good working order for many years to come. This will make your coffee as delicious and tasty as it can be.

You can try a few things if your Delonghi coffee machine is not producing hot water. Make sure that the machine is turned on and plugged in. If the light is blinking or isn't working, it could be due to a power issue or there could be an issue with the tank's water level. If this is the case, you will be required to contact the customer service department of DeLonghi.

A common issue common to Delonghi espresso machines is that the pump isn't working properly. This problem may be caused by a faulty sensor or a malfunctioning motor. This is usually caused by limescale accumulation in the pipes of the machine. It can be eliminated by descaling. If the problem continues, you may have to replace the pump.

If your coffee maker fails to produce any water, there could be an electrical issue. Examine the fuse and make sure it has not blown. Replace it as quickly as possible in the event that it has blown. If this is not enough to solve the issue then you can turn off the machine and drain it to eliminate any sludge.
